Best time to go to Corner Brook

The best time to visit Corner Brook is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. February is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is very c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January20.7°F (-6.3°C)Light RainVery C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February18.7°F (-7.4°C)Light RainVery CloudyModerately LowAverage
March23.0°F (-5.0°C)Light RainVery CloudyAverageAverage
April32.5°F (0.3°C)Light RainVery CloudyModerately HighAverage
May42.1°F (5.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June52.5°F (11.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
July60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
August61.2°F (16.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September53.8°F (12.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
October44.2°F (6.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November34.9°F (1.6°C)Light RainVery C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
December26.8°F (-2.9°C)Light RainVery C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Corner Brook

Accessing Corner Brook, Newfoundland and Labrador, is convenient via two major airports. Deer Lake Regional Airport (YDF) is situated 50km away, with nearby accommodation options such as the Driftwood Inn and Deer Lake Horizon Hotel, both 5km from the airport. Additionally, a resort offering romantic rooms with water views is located 3km from YDF. Alternatively, Stephenville International Airport (YJT) lies 64km from Corner Brook, featuring hotels like the 4-star Days Inn by Wyndham, just 805m from YJT, and Dreamcatcher Lodge, 2km away. For a charming stay, The Palace Inn is a bed and breakfast located 14km from the airport.

What's the seasonal weather like in Corner Brook?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of -5°C. The snowiest months in Corner Brook are January, February, March and December, with each month seeing an average of 63 cm of snowfall.
